Own Correspondent, Dhaka, April 15: Dhaka South City Corporation (DSCC) Mayor Sheikh Fazle Noor Taposh has said that the nation will move forward by embracing Bengali culture.

The mayor made the remarks while exchanging views with the media after observing Chayanat's New Year celebrations at Ramna Batamul on Thursday morning.

Mayor Sheikh Tapas said, "Today we have gathered at Ramna Batamul. This New Year celebration of Ramna Batamul is one of the inseparable part of our national culture. This cultural mix of Ramna Batamul with our history and tradition satisfies us and gives totality to Bengaliness. So if we want to move forward, we have to move forward by embracing Bengali culture."

Expressing his happiness that the event has resumed after a two-year hiatus due to Covid-19 pandemic, Taposh said, "It has to be spread widely among the new generation. Only then the fullness of Bengali culture will be revealed to a great extent."

The mayor wished the people of Dhaka and the country a happy Bengali New Year. At 6:30 am, DSCC Mayor attended the New Year celebrations organized by Chayanat at Ramna Batamul and left the venue after 8 am.
